Apa itu hosting dan bagaimana kaitannya dengan CMS?
Apa Itu Web Hosting?
Apa itu hosting dan bagaimana kaitannya dengan CMS? – Di era digital yang serba cepat ini, keberadaan di dunia maya menjadi sebuah keniscayaan, layaknya memiliki rumah di dunia nyata. Website Anda, ibarat rumah digital Anda, membutuhkan tempat tinggal yang aman, handal, dan nyaman. Nah, web hosting inilah penyedia tempat tinggal tersebut. Bayangkan, tanpa hosting, website Anda tak akan pernah bisa dilihat oleh siapapun di internet.
Hosting adalah layanan penyedia ruang penyimpanan data website Anda di internet, sementara CMS (Content Management System) seperti WordPress adalah perangkat lunak untuk membangun dan mengelola situs. Keduanya saling berkaitan; CMS membutuhkan hosting untuk beroperasi. Ingin website Anda lebih dari sekadar statis? Pertimbangkan fitur interaktif dengan membangun website dinamis, seperti yang dijelaskan di Website Dinamis Tambahkan Fitur Interaktif.
Dengan hosting yang tepat dan CMS yang handal, Anda dapat menghadirkan pengalaman pengguna yang lebih kaya dan menarik. Kecepatan loading website pun sangat dipengaruhi oleh kualitas hosting yang dipilih.
Jenis-jenis Web Hosting, Apa itu hosting dan bagaimana kaitannya dengan CMS?
Layaknya memilih tempat tinggal, terdapat beragam pilihan jenis web hosting yang dapat disesuaikan dengan kebutuhan dan anggaran Anda. Masing-masing menawarkan fitur dan kapasitas yang berbeda, sehingga penting untuk memahami karakteristiknya sebelum menentukan pilihan.
- Shared Hosting: Mirip seperti tinggal di kos-kosan. Anda berbagi sumber daya server (CPU, memori, dan bandwidth) dengan banyak pengguna lain. Biaya relatif murah, namun performa dan keamanan mungkin terbatas.
- VPS (Virtual Private Server) Hosting: Seperti tinggal di rumah kontrakan. Anda memiliki ruang server virtual sendiri, tetapi masih berbagi sumber daya fisik server dengan pengguna lain. Memberikan lebih banyak kontrol dan performa yang lebih baik daripada shared hosting, dengan biaya yang lebih tinggi.
- Dedicated Hosting: Layaknya memiliki rumah pribadi mewah. Anda mendapatkan seluruh sumber daya server untuk diri sendiri tanpa berbagi dengan siapapun. Performa terbaik, keamanan terjamin, namun dengan biaya yang paling mahal.
Kelebihan dan Kekurangan Masing-masing Jenis Web Hosting
Memilih jenis hosting yang tepat sangat krusial. Pertimbangkan kebutuhan website Anda, anggaran, dan tingkat keahlian teknis Anda dalam pengambilan keputusan.
Hosting adalah layanan penyedia ruang penyimpanan online untuk website Anda, sementara CMS (Content Management System) seperti WordPress adalah perangkat lunak untuk membangun dan mengelola website tersebut. Keduanya saling berkaitan erat; hosting menyediakan tempat website Anda ‘tinggal’, sementara CMS menjadi ‘rumahnya’. Agar website Anda tampil menarik dan efektif, perhatikan juga tips dan trik desain website yang mumpuni seperti yang dibahas di Desain Website Menawan Tips dan Trik Sukses.
Pemilihan hosting yang tepat dan penggunaan CMS yang efisien akan sangat menentukan performa dan tampilan website Anda secara keseluruhan.
Jenis Hosting | Harga | Performa | Keamanan |
---|---|---|---|
Shared Hosting | Murah | Rendah | Rendah |
VPS Hosting | Sedang | Sedang | Sedang |
Dedicated Hosting | Mahal | Tinggi | Tinggi |
Ilustrasi Kapasitas dan Sumber Daya
Untuk lebih mudah memahami perbedaannya, mari kita gunakan analogi tempat tinggal. Shared hosting seperti apartemen kos dengan fasilitas terbatas dan berbagi dengan penghuni lain. VPS hosting seperti rumah kontrakan, memiliki privasi lebih dan fasilitas yang lebih baik. Sedangkan dedicated hosting adalah seperti rumah pribadi mewah dengan fasilitas lengkap dan eksklusif, hanya untuk Anda.
Apa Itu CMS?: Apa Itu Hosting Dan Bagaimana Kaitannya Dengan CMS?
Di era digital yang serba cepat ini, mengelola konten website menjadi kunci keberhasilan. Bayangkan Anda harus mengedit setiap baris kode setiap kali ingin mengubah teks atau gambar di website Anda. Betapa melelahkannya! Di sinilah peran Content Management System (CMS) menjadi sangat krusial. CMS adalah solusi praktis dan efisien untuk membangun dan mengelola website tanpa perlu keahlian pemrograman tingkat tinggi. Ia seperti sebuah “rumah pintar” untuk website Anda, memudahkan Anda dalam mengatur dan memperbarui konten.
Dengan CMS, Anda dapat dengan mudah menambahkan, mengedit, dan menghapus konten website tanpa harus berurusan dengan kode-kode rumit. Hal ini memungkinkan Anda untuk fokus pada hal yang lebih penting, yaitu menciptakan konten yang menarik dan berkualitas untuk audiens Anda.
Contoh CMS Populer
Beberapa CMS telah mendapatkan popularitas luas karena kemudahan penggunaan dan fitur-fitur canggihnya. Keberadaan berbagai pilihan CMS memungkinkan Anda untuk memilih yang paling sesuai dengan kebutuhan dan skala bisnis Anda.
Hosting adalah layanan penyewaan ruang server untuk menyimpan website, sementara CMS (Content Management System) seperti WordPress merupakan perangkat lunak untuk membangun dan mengelola website tersebut. Keduanya saling berkaitan; hosting menyediakan tempat, sedangkan CMS menyediakan alat. Namun, sekeren apapun CMS yang digunakan, website tetap membutuhkan daya tarik visual. Untuk itu, desain UI/UX yang mumpuni sangat penting, seperti yang dibahas di Desain UI/UX yang Menarik untuk Website.
Dengan UI/UX yang baik, website yang dihosting dan dibangun dengan CMS akan lebih efektif menarik pengunjung. Oleh karena itu, pemilihan hosting yang handal dan CMS yang tepat menjadi fondasi utama keberhasilan sebuah website.
- WordPress: Terkenal dengan kemudahan penggunaannya dan basis plugin yang luas. Cocok untuk berbagai jenis website, dari blog pribadi hingga toko online.
- Joomla: Menawarkan fleksibilitas tinggi dan cocok untuk website yang lebih kompleks. Membutuhkan sedikit lebih banyak pengetahuan teknis dibandingkan WordPress.
- Drupal: Dikembangkan untuk website yang sangat besar dan kompleks, membutuhkan keahlian teknis yang lebih tinggi. Sering digunakan untuk website pemerintahan atau korporasi.
Fungsi Utama CMS
Fungsi utama CMS adalah menyederhanakan proses pembuatan dan pengelolaan website. Ini terwujud dalam beberapa fungsi inti yang saling berkaitan, membentuk sebuah sistem yang terintegrasi dan efisien.
- Penyuntingan Konten: Memungkinkan pengguna untuk menambahkan, mengedit, dan menghapus konten website dengan antarmuka yang user-friendly, tanpa perlu keahlian coding.
- Pengelolaan Media: Memudahkan pengguna untuk mengunggah, mengelola, dan mengatur berbagai jenis media seperti gambar, video, dan audio.
- Pengaturan Template dan Tema: Memungkinkan pengguna untuk menyesuaikan tampilan website dengan berbagai template dan tema yang tersedia, tanpa harus merubah kode.
- Pengelolaan Pengguna: Memungkinkan administrator untuk mengelola pengguna website, memberikan akses dan izin yang berbeda-beda.
- Integrasi Plugin dan Ekstensi: Memungkinkan pengguna untuk memperluas fungsionalitas website dengan menambahkan plugin atau ekstensi.
Alasan Bisnis Membutuhkan CMS
Dalam dunia bisnis, efisiensi dan efektivitas adalah kunci keberhasilan. CMS menawarkan solusi yang tepat untuk memenuhi kebutuhan tersebut dalam hal pengelolaan website.
Hosting adalah layanan penyedia tempat penyimpanan data website, sementara CMS (Content Management System) adalah sistem pengelola konten website. Keduanya saling berkaitan; CMS membutuhkan hosting untuk beroperasi. Bayangkan website Anda sebagai sebuah rumah, hosting adalah lahannya, dan CMS adalah desain interiornya. Untuk website yang memberikan pengalaman pengguna seamless seperti aplikasi native, pertimbangkan solusi Website PWA Pengalaman Seperti Aplikasi Native , yang tetap membutuhkan hosting dan CMS yang handal untuk menjalankan fungsinya.
Pemilihan hosting yang tepat sangat krusial untuk performa website, termasuk website PWA, agar dapat diakses dengan cepat dan stabil.
- Efisiensi Waktu: Mengurangi waktu yang dibutuhkan untuk mengelola website, sehingga Anda dapat fokus pada aspek bisnis lainnya.
- Kemudahan Penggunaan: Tidak membutuhkan keahlian pemrograman, sehingga siapa pun dapat mengelola website.
- Biaya yang Efektif: Meminimalkan biaya pengembangan dan pemeliharaan website.
- Skalabilitas: Mudah untuk memperluas dan mengembangkan website sesuai dengan kebutuhan bisnis yang berkembang.
- Peningkatan : Banyak CMS yang memiliki fitur-fitur yang mendukung optimasi mesin pencari ().
Perbandingan Tiga CMS Populer
Pemilihan CMS yang tepat sangat bergantung pada kebutuhan dan skala bisnis Anda. Perbandingan berikut memberikan gambaran umum mengenai tiga CMS populer.
Fitur | WordPress | Joomla | Drupal |
---|---|---|---|
Kemudahan Penggunaan | Sangat Mudah | Sedang | Sulit |
Fleksibilitas | Tinggi (dengan plugin) | Sangat Tinggi | Sangat Tinggi |
Keamanan | Sedang (tergantung plugin dan tema) | Sedang | Tinggi |
Hubungan Web Hosting dan CMS
Dalam dunia digital yang serba cepat ini, keberadaan website layaknya sebuah rumah bagi bisnis atau personal branding Anda. Namun, rumah tersebut tak akan berdiri kokoh tanpa pondasi yang kuat. Web hosting adalah pondasi itu, tempat website Anda ‘tinggal’, sementara CMS (Content Management System) adalah arsitek dan pengelola isi rumah tersebut. Keduanya saling bergantung dan berkolaborasi untuk menghadirkan website yang fungsional dan menarik.
Bayangkan sebuah rumah mewah tanpa pondasi yang kokoh. Begitu pula website tanpa web hosting yang handal. Keberadaan web hosting memastikan website Anda selalu dapat diakses oleh pengguna internet. Tanpa hosting, website Anda hanyalah sekumpulan file yang tersimpan di komputer lokal, tak terlihat oleh dunia luar. CMS, di sisi lain, memudahkan Anda untuk membangun dan mengelola isi website tanpa harus menulis kode program yang rumit. Ia bagaikan seorang arsitek yang merancang tata letak rumah dan seorang tukang bangunan yang mengelola isi rumah secara efektif.
Ketergantungan CMS pada Web Hosting
CMS, seperti WordPress, Joomla, atau Drupal, membutuhkan web hosting untuk beroperasi. Data website, termasuk file-file, database, dan kode program, disimpan di server web hosting. Saat pengguna mengakses website, server hosting akan mengirimkan data tersebut ke browser pengguna. Tanpa hosting, CMS tidak akan memiliki tempat untuk menyimpan dan menyajikan kontennya. Proses ini berlangsung secara otomatis dan transparan bagi pengguna, namun pemahaman dasar mengenai interaksi ini penting untuk mengelola website secara efektif.
Proses Instalasi CMS pada Web Hosting
Instalasi CMS pada web hosting relatif mudah, terutama dengan bantuan aplikasi instalasi satu klik seperti Softaculous yang sering tersedia di panel kontrol hosting seperti cPanel. Proses ini melibatkan beberapa langkah sederhana, namun pemahaman dasar mengenai setiap langkah akan memastikan instalasi yang lancar dan aman. Berikut ini beberapa poin penting yang perlu diperhatikan.
- Memilih penyedia web hosting yang sesuai dengan kebutuhan CMS dan skala website. Pertimbangkan faktor seperti kapasitas penyimpanan, bandwidth, dan fitur keamanan.
- Memilih dan mengunduh paket instalasi CMS yang kompatibel dengan versi PHP dan database server yang disediakan oleh hosting.
- Mengunggah file CMS ke direktori yang tepat di server web hosting, biasanya melalui FTP atau File Manager di cPanel.
- Menjalankan skrip instalasi CMS dan mengikuti petunjuk yang diberikan. Langkah ini biasanya melibatkan pembuatan database dan konfigurasi pengaturan CMS.
- Mengisi informasi penting seperti nama website, username, dan password untuk akses admin.
- Setelah instalasi selesai, CMS siap digunakan untuk membangun dan mengelola konten website.
Contoh Instalasi WordPress pada Hosting cPanel
Sebagai contoh praktis, berikut langkah-langkah umum instalasi WordPress melalui Softaculous di cPanel:
> 1. Masuk ke cPanel.
> 2. Klik Softaculous Apps Installer.
> 3. Pilih WordPress.
> 4. Ikuti petunjuk instalasi, termasuk memilih domain, membuat nama pengguna dan kata sandi, dan menentukan detail database.
> 5. Setelah proses instalasi selesai, Anda akan mendapatkan link untuk mengakses dashboard WordPress.
Masalah Umum Instalasi CMS dan Cara Mengatasinya
Selama proses instalasi, beberapa masalah umum mungkin terjadi. Ketidakcocokan versi PHP, masalah konfigurasi database, atau kesalahan izin file adalah beberapa di antaranya. Penting untuk memahami pesan kesalahan yang ditampilkan dan mencari solusi yang tepat. Forum dukungan komunitas CMS dan dokumentasi resmi seringkali menjadi sumber informasi yang berharga. Konsultasi dengan tim dukungan teknis penyedia web hosting juga merupakan langkah yang bijaksana jika masalah persisten.
Pentingnya Memilih Web Hosting yang Sesuai
Memilih web hosting yang tepat sangat krusial. Hosting yang kurang bertenaga dapat mengakibatkan website lambat dan tidak responsif, terutama jika CMS yang digunakan kompleks dan memiliki banyak konten. Sebaliknya, hosting yang terlalu bertenaga mungkin tidak ekonomis. Pertimbangkan kebutuhan spesifik CMS, volume trafik yang diantisipasi, dan fitur keamanan yang dibutuhkan saat memilih paket hosting. Pertimbangkan juga reputasi dan kualitas layanan purna jual penyedia hosting untuk memastikan pengalaman yang lancar dan dukungan yang memadai.
FAQ: Pertanyaan Umum Seputar Web Hosting dan CMS
Memilih web hosting dan CMS yang tepat adalah langkah krusial dalam membangun kehadiran online yang sukses. Keberhasilan website Anda, baik dari segi performa, keamanan, hingga biaya operasional, sangat bergantung pada pemahaman yang baik tentang kedua hal ini. Berikut beberapa pertanyaan umum yang sering muncul, beserta jawabannya, untuk membantu Anda dalam perjalanan membangun website impian.
Memilih Web Hosting yang Tepat
Pemilihan web hosting yang tepat bergantung pada beberapa faktor kunci. Pertama, pertimbangkan kebutuhan situs web Anda. Apakah situs Anda diperkirakan akan menerima trafik tinggi atau rendah? Berapa banyak ruang penyimpanan dan bandwidth yang dibutuhkan? Apakah Anda memerlukan fitur-fitur khusus seperti sertifikat SSL atau email hosting? Kedua, sesuaikan pilihan hosting dengan jenis CMS yang Anda gunakan. Beberapa hosting menawarkan optimasi khusus untuk CMS tertentu, seperti WordPress atau Joomla. Terakhir, tentukan budget Anda. Ada berbagai pilihan hosting dengan harga yang bervariasi, dari yang paling ekonomis hingga yang paling premium, masing-masing dengan fitur dan kapabilitas yang berbeda. Mempertimbangkan ketiga faktor ini secara seimbang akan membantu Anda menemukan solusi hosting yang ideal.
Kompatibilitas Web Hosting dan CMS
Mayoritas penyedia web hosting menawarkan kompatibilitas dengan CMS populer seperti WordPress, Joomla, dan Drupal. Namun, penting untuk melakukan pengecekan kompatibilitas sebelum melakukan komitmen. Beberapa hosting mungkin menawarkan instalasi CMS satu klik, yang mempermudah proses setup. Namun, selalu periksa spesifikasi hosting dan persyaratan sistem CMS Anda untuk memastikan kesesuaian yang optimal. Ketidakcocokan dapat menyebabkan masalah teknis dan menghambat kinerja website.
Biaya Web Hosting dan CMS
Biaya web hosting dan CMS bervariasi secara signifikan. Faktor-faktor yang mempengaruhi biaya termasuk jenis hosting (shared hosting, VPS, dedicated server), fitur yang ditawarkan, dan tingkat dukungan pelanggan. CMS itu sendiri umumnya gratis (seperti WordPress), namun Anda mungkin perlu membayar untuk tema premium, plugin, atau layanan pendukung lainnya. Secara umum, hosting shared merupakan pilihan paling ekonomis, sementara VPS dan dedicated server menawarkan lebih banyak sumber daya dan fleksibilitas dengan biaya yang lebih tinggi. Pertimbangkan kebutuhan dan budget Anda untuk memilih paket yang paling sesuai.
Mengelola CMS Setelah Instalasi
Setelah instalasi CMS, memahami dashboard dan antarmuka admin sangat penting. Kebanyakan CMS modern dirancang dengan antarmuka yang intuitif, namun tetap perlu waktu untuk mempelajari fitur-fitur utamanya. Manfaatkan tutorial, dokumentasi, dan komunitas online yang tersedia. Banyak sumber daya online menawarkan panduan langkah demi langkah untuk mengelola berbagai aspek CMS, mulai dari pembuatan konten hingga pengaturan keamanan. Jangan ragu untuk mencari bantuan jika Anda mengalami kesulitan.
Menangani Masalah Situs Web
Jika situs web Anda mengalami masalah, langkah pertama adalah memeriksa log error dan dokumentasi penyedia hosting Anda. Banyak masalah umum dapat dipecahkan dengan memeriksa konfigurasi server atau melakukan troubleshooting dasar. Jika masalah tetap berlanjut, hubungi tim dukungan teknis penyedia hosting Anda. Mereka memiliki akses ke log server dan dapat membantu mendiagnosis masalah lebih lanjut. Komunitas pengguna CMS juga dapat menjadi sumber bantuan yang berharga. Forum online dan grup dukungan seringkali memiliki solusi untuk masalah umum yang dihadapi pengguna.